Abstract

The C13(d,n) and C14(d,n) cross sections have been measured for 0.2≤Ec.m.≤2.1 MeV and 0.2≤Ec.m.≤1.3 MeV, respectively, using a 4π neutron detector. The cross sections are used to calculate the thermonuclear reaction rates for temperatures below 10 GK. The implications of these and other new nuclear-physics results for inhomogeneous primordial nucleosynthesis are discussed.
